This course is a must play! A very beautiful park that is well maintained and surrounds a lake. The course is designed for all levels of players with several alternate baskets that keeps it mixed up. Brand new tee signs are top class and will keep you well guided through all 18 holes. About 4 holes hug the side of the lake so keep them dry & watch out for the gators! Otherwise your looking at mild tree coverage & creative pin placements!

Other Thoughts:

Friendly hadicap round every Sunday @ 10am & blind draw doubles every Tuesday @6 pm
